[jboss-cvs] JBossAS SVN: r111888 - branches/JBPAPP_5_1/cluster/src/main/org/jboss/profileservice/cluster/repository.
jboss-cvs-commits at lists.jboss.org
jboss-cvs-commits at lists.jboss.org
Fri Jul 29 17:37:44 EDT 2011
Author: dereed
Date: 2011-07-29 17:37:43 -0400 (Fri, 29 Jul 2011)
New Revision: 111888
Modified:
branches/JBPAPP_5_1/cluster/src/main/org/jboss/profileservice/cluster/repository/DefaultRepositoryClusteringHandler.java
Log:
[JBPAPP-6933] Fix possible race condition in farm service when merging before service is fully started.
Modified: branches/JBPAPP_5_1/cluster/src/main/org/jboss/profileservice/cluster/repository/DefaultRepositoryClusteringHandler.java
===================================================================
--- branches/JBPAPP_5_1/cluster/src/main/org/jboss/profileservice/cluster/repository/DefaultRepositoryClusteringHandler.java 2011-07-29 21:03:31 UTC (rev 111887)
+++ branches/JBPAPP_5_1/cluster/src/main/org/jboss/profileservice/cluster/repository/DefaultRepositoryClusteringHandler.java 2011-07-29 21:37:43 UTC (rev 111888)
@@ -1163,7 +1163,7 @@
if (merge)
{
ClusterNode master = (ClusterNode) (newReplicants.size() > 0 ? newReplicants.get(0) : null);
- inSync = (master != null && oldView.contains(master));
+ inSync = inSync && (master != null && oldView.contains(master));
}
}
}
More information about the jboss-cvs-commits
mailing list